From 6a657819509c4765fe7ad98fe768ec97d1b02a59 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E2=98=99=E2=97=A6=20The=20Tablet=20=E2=9D=80=20GamerGirla?= =?UTF-8?q?ndCo=20=E2=97=A6=E2=9D=A7?= Date: Sat, 30 Dec 2023 16:08:57 -0500 Subject: [PATCH] refactor(nuxt): make nitro preset conditional set nitro preset to `bun` in production, otherwise keep `node-server` --- nuxt.config.ts | 11 +++++++++-- 1 file changed, 9 insertions(+), 2 deletions(-) diff --git a/nuxt.config.ts b/nuxt.config.ts index 7304cf9..c0f2c94 100644 --- a/nuxt.config.ts +++ b/nuxt.config.ts @@ -84,10 +84,10 @@ export default defineNuxtConfig({ esbuild: { options: { minify: true, - sourceMap: "inline", + // sourceMap: "inline", }, }, - preset: "node-server", + preset: process.env.NODE_ENV == "production" ? "bun" : "node-server", }, routeRules: { "/": cac, @@ -161,4 +161,11 @@ export default defineNuxtConfig({ exclude: ["./.nuxt/types/auth.d.ts"], }, }, + imports: { + autoImport: true, + + dirsScanOptions: { + types: true, + }, + }, });